In chrysoberyl, a compound containing beryllium, aluminium and oxygen, oxide ions form cubic close packed structure. Aluminium ions occupy \(\frac{1}{4}\) th of octahedral voids. The formula of the compound is
- A \(\mathrm{BeAlO}_{4}\)
- B \(\mathrm{BeAl}_{2} \mathrm{O}_{4}\)
- C \(\mathrm{Be}_{2} \mathrm{AlO}_{2}\)
- D \(\mathrm{BeAlO}_{2}\)
Answer & Solution
Correct Answer
(B) \(\mathrm{BeAl}_{2} \mathrm{O}_{4}\)
Step-by-step Solution
Detailed explanation
Given, chrysoberyl forms ccp structure.
Oxygen occupies lattice points \(=N\) (say)
Al occupies \(\frac{1}{2}\) of octahedral voids \(=\frac{N}{2}\)
Be occupies \(\frac{1}{8}\) of tetrahedral voids \(=\frac{2 N}{8}\)
\(\therefore\) The formula of compound is
\(\begin{aligned}
&\mathrm{Be}: \mathrm{Al}: \mathrm{O} \\
&\frac{2 N}{8}: \frac{N}{2}: N \\
&\Rightarrow \quad \mathrm{BeAl}_{2} \mathrm{O}_{4}
\end{aligned}\)
